Latest revision as of 17:11, 25 July 2012
Agenda
Time: Wed July 25, 2012, 16:00 - 16:45 Europe/Rome
Conference call agenda:
- Activity Status
- Activity plan till the next TCOM
- Review use case
Participants
- Andrea Manzi (CERN)
- Nikolaos Drakopoulos (CERN)
- Gianpaolo Coro (CNR)
- Gerasimos Farantatos (NKUA)
- Alex Antoniadis (NKUA)
Minutes
Activity Status
NKUA has worked during the month in the mavenization fo the gRS2 and Madgik commons library. in parallel some enhancements have been also
- increase transfer performances
- Error handling (https://issue.imarine.research-infrastructures.eu/ticket/526)
this new version is under integration by the streams API. Some changes have been performed at the level of initialization for the HTTP transfers.
CERN has worked mainly at:
- enhancements on the Agent Service ( async transfer handling)
- Agent library compliancy with the CL framework
- Scheduler Service design
- Scheduler DB library implementation ( using DataNucleus)
Plan till TCOM
The changes on gRS library will be released in the next gCube minor release ( end of august - beginning of september)
CERN is going to release the enhancements on the Agent service and Library and a first version of the Scheduler Service and Library in the next minor
CERN is going to work on a first version of the Data transfer Widget, which will be used to scheduled transfer trough the portal.
Review
Gianpaolo explains the Geospatial use cases to be implemented fo the review.
He expressed the need to perform some transfers using the CERN data transfer facilities and he would like to know some performance indicators
CERN will update soon the Agent Service running on the Thredds Machine and perform some test with Data coming from MyOcean
Gianpaolo to send MyOcean credentials to CERN in order to perform the test on real data.
